Output c73cd315ab2ca1c5ad51a3a798d26db918167756cb1d8d23e92855298d2583db:1

value
2079545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ea6905a2a3a666b3ceda3fbff96c24e4bcb033 OP_EQUAL
address
3MTxh65FaYh7DoCF487UTs4ZmrQ3TP5wKg
transaction
c73cd315ab2ca1c5ad51a3a798d26db918167756cb1d8d23e92855298d2583db
spent
true